What refusal means
The process from here
The council refused this application for the reasons set out on the decision notice, which the council portal holds in full. Only the applicant can appeal a refusal; the time limit runs from the decision date and is shorter for householder schemes.
Refusal does not prevent a fresh attempt. Applicants often address the reasons for refusal and resubmit, so a refused scheme is not necessarily the end of proposals for the site.
About trees applications
How this application type works
Tree applications cover work to protected trees: those under a tree preservation order need consent for pruning or felling, and trees in a conservation area need six weeks written notice before work starts. The council assesses the amenity value of the tree and can refuse consent, approve it with conditions, or in conservation areas make a preservation order in response.
